Here are our top summer maintenance tips to protect and preserve your hardwood floors.
Put Down Protective Mats (Especially at Entry Points)
Sand and small pebbles are your floor’s worst enemy. Placing doormats both outside and inside your entryways helps trap grit before it gets tracked through the house. For homes near the beach, rinse your feet or shoes before walking inside—even tiny grains of sand can cause scratches over time.
Use Felt Pads Under Furniture Legs
Summertime often means rearranging furniture for gatherings, opening up space, or adding fans. Before sliding anything across your floor, make sure it has felt pads or protective glides. They prevent scuff marks and dents from sudden movement or daily shifting.
Stick to Dry or Damp Mopping
Skip the wet mops or steamers, which can damage the finish or seep moisture into joints. Instead, sweep daily or use a microfiber dust mop. For deeper cleaning, use a slightly damp cloth or a hardwood-specific cleaning solution and mop.
Rotate Rugs and Rearrange Furniture
UV rays can fade or darken sections of hardwood, depending on wood type and finish. Rotating rugs and shifting furniture helps reduce uneven fading and keep your floors aging gracefully. If your space gets lots of direct sun, consider using sheer curtains or blinds during peak daylight hours.
Keep Pet Nails Trimmed
Dogs and cats may love lounging on cool wood floors in summer, but their nails can leave behind scratches and marks, especially during play. Regular trimming and keeping a rug in high-traffic pet areas can protect your surface from everyday wear.
Avoid Dragging Beach Gear or Coolers
It’s tempting to slide heavy coolers, beach bags, or sports gear across the floor, but even soft bottoms can catch grit underneath. Always lift and carry items—or lay down a towel or mat for staging gear during summer outings.
